Snoqualmie Falls
The Snoqualmie River plunges 270 feet to form prodigious waterfalls, digit of Washington Stateâs most popular scenic attractions. More than 1.5 million visitors come to the falls every year. At the falls, there is also a tow-acre park, hiking trail, observations deck and a gift shop.
